GPS trackers for cars use advanced technology to provide real-time information about vehicle location and security. They help car owners keep track of their vehicles, enhancing safety and reducing theft risks. Here’s a closer look at how this technology works, the different types available, and their benefits.
GPS trackers operate using signals from satellites to determine a vehicle's location. They utilize a method called trilateration, which calculates position based on distances from at least three satellites. This technology allows for precise location tracking.
Many car GPS trackers can provide real-time updates to users via a mobile app or web platform. This means owners can see where their vehicle is at any moment.
Features often include speed tracking and alerts for unauthorized movement, which can help deter theft.

GPS trackers for cars with audio offer a range of features that enhance security and usability. These capabilities make monitoring vehicles easier and provide valuable information when needed. Below are some key functionalities that users should consider.
Real-time location updates are a critical feature of GPS trackers. This allows users to see their vehicle’s position at any moment.
Most devices provide updates every 30 seconds, ensuring accurate tracking.
Users can access this information through dedicated apps or web platforms. This enables convenient monitoring from anywhere.
With precise location tracking, the device minimizes the chance of losing the vehicle or theft.
Additionally, many GPS trackers utilize 4G LTE networks for reliable connectivity. This supports rapid updates and improved accuracy in determining location. Overall, real-time updates are essential for vehicle owners wanting peace of mind.
Geofencing enables users to set virtual boundaries around specific areas. These boundaries can restrict movement and send alerts if the vehicle crosses them.
This feature is beneficial for monitoring unauthorized use or ensuring compliance with predetermined routes.
Users receive instant notifications if the vehicle leaves a designated zone. This adds an extra layer of security. It is ideal for families monitoring teenage drivers or businesses tracking company vehicles.
Geofencing also provides insights into driving habits. Users can analyze how often the vehicle enters or exits specific areas, which may help in adjusting routes or schedules for better efficiency.
Alerts and notifications are vital for keeping vehicle owners informed. GPS trackers can send various alerts, such as unauthorized movement, speed limits exceeded, and low battery warnings.
These notifications usually come through a smartphone app or via email. They enable quick responses to potential issues.
For example, owners can act swiftly if their vehicle is being tampered with or if it strays outside a set geofence.
Some devices also offer impact detection alerts. This feature notifies the owner if the vehicle has been involved in an accident. Overall, timely alerts help users maintain a secure awareness of their vehicle's status.
Live audio monitoring is a notable feature of some GPS trackers. This allows users to call the tracker’s built-in SIM card to listen to audio in the vicinity of the device.
This feature is useful for discreetly checking on what is happening around the vehicle. It can be beneficial in situations of theft or if the owner suspects unauthorized use.
For better security, many devices offer a two-way communication feature. This functionality allows direct conversation, providing an extra layer of monitoring. Live audio monitoring enhances the functionality of GPS trackers, making them even more useful for vehicle owners seeking comprehensive security solutions.

When considering GPS trackers for cars with audio, understanding pricing and subscription models is crucial. This section outlines the costs involved and the terms that come with different subscription options.
Pricing for GPS trackers that include audio features can vary widely. Basic models may start at around $22.99, while more advanced trackers can cost between $100 and $300.
Many of these trackers require a monthly subscription, which typically ranges from $12.99 to $34.99. This fee often covers services like real-time tracking and audio monitoring.
Some devices might not function fully without an active subscription, so it's essential to read the fine print. Cost considerations should include both the upfront price of the tracker and ongoing subscription fees to ensure it fits within a user’s budget.
Before choosing a GPS tracker with audio, examining the terms and conditions is vital.
Many subscription services offer a money-back guarantee within a specific period, which allows users to test the device risk-free.
On the other hand, some subscriptions might include hidden fees or a requirement for long-term commitments.
Understanding the cancellation policy is equally important. Users should know if they can end the subscription at any time without penalties.

When using a GPS tracker for a car with audio capabilities, understanding the legal and ethical landscape is vital. Privacy laws, user consent, and responsible tracking practices shape how these devices should be used.
Privacy laws vary widely by region, making it crucial for users to understand the specific regulations where they live.
In many places, individuals must obtain explicit consent before tracking someone's vehicle. For example, under the Fourth Amendment, attaching a GPS device without a warrant can be considered a violation of privacy rights.
Before placing a tracker, it is best to inform the vehicle owner. This transparency helps in maintaining trust and complies with legal requirements. Failure to obtain proper consent may result in civil or criminal penalties, depending on the jurisdiction.
Furthermore, organizations must ensure they are complying with any applicable data protection laws. This includes secure data storage and limiting access to tracking information.
Ethical concerns surrounding GPS tracking are significant. Users should respect the privacy rights of others and consider the implications of surveillance.
Using a tracker in personal vehicles should always align with clear communication and mutual agreement.
When vehicles belong to employees, employers must tread carefully. It is essential to inform employees about the tracking use to align with ethical practices. The misuse of GPS tracking can lead to feelings of invasion, reduced trust, and damage to relationships.
Additionally, ensuring that audio features are used responsibly is vital. Audio recording without consent raises serious ethical and legal issues. It is crucial to evaluate the necessity and appropriateness of using audio in conjunction with GPS tracking.
